Mixon Career May Be Over After Injury
Joe Mixon’s NFL career appears to be over after a serious foot injury that required surgery ahead of the 2025 season. Although his overall health and quality of life have improved, multiple reports indicate he is unlikely to play again, with some sources noting there’s a glimmer of hope but retirement is the more probable outcome. He has not formally filed retirement papers, but conversations with former Bengals teammates suggest his playing days are finished. Officials have rejected rumors about the injury, including sensational claims about shooting himself in the foot or other improbable causes. Mixon played seven seasons with the Bengals before a 2024 trade to the Texans, where he posted notable production in his first year with Houston. Even as teams reportedly monitor him, insiders say there is little indication he’ll return to football, and recent reports quote Mixon as telling friends his career is likely over.
